Capital One releases VulnHunter, an open-source AI tool that finds software flaws before hackers do
Capital One has released VulnHunter, an open-source AI security tool designed to proactively identify and remediate software vulnerabilities before they can be exploited. Built internally and now available on GitHub, VulnHunter employs an "attacker-first forward analysis" and a built-in falsification engine to pinpoint exploitable code paths and suggest fixes—a departure from traditional vulnerability scanners. This move represents a significant evolution for Capital One, demonstrating a commitment to open-source collaboration as a cornerstone of its cybersecurity strategy.

Brex built its AI agent policy by watching what agents actually do, not by writing rules first
Brex addressed a critical challenge in agent security by observing actual agent behavior rather than relying on predefined rules. Recognizing that traditional guardrails struggle to contain agents wielding real-world credentials like API keys, they developed CrabTrap, an open-source HTTP/HTTPS proxy. This innovative platform uses an LLM-as-a-judge to evaluate network requests, learning from real-time agent activity to enforce policies. The agent evaluation gap: Enterprise AI organizations have a reality-alignment problem, not a coverage problem — and most are shipping to production anyway
Enterprise AI organizations face a critical reality-alignment problem: an “evaluation gap” where increasing agent autonomy outpaces trust in the evaluations meant to govern it. A recent VentureBeat Pulse Research survey of 157 enterprises reveals that half have already deployed an agent that passed internal evaluations but subsequently failed a customer. Only 5% fully trust automated evaluation, citing a key weakness – evaluations often don't reflect real-world outcomes. Despite this, two-thirds are moving toward fully automated deployments, highlighting a pressing need for more reliable assurance.

Amazon AGI director says AI agent reliability, not capability, is blocking enterprise deployment at VB Transform 2026
Amazon AGI director Bryan Silverthorn identifies a critical obstacle to enterprise AI agent deployment: reliability, not simply capability. Addressing VentureBeat's Transform 2026 audience, Silverthorn highlighted a concerning trend—85% of enterprises pilot AI agents, yet only 5% reach production. He proposes a framework of consistency, robustness, predictability, and safety to measure agent performance, noting that many agents excel in internal evaluations but falter in real-world use. Ultimately, successful deployment hinges on strong management practices, not just advanced models.

Forget typosquatting; slopsquatting is the software supply chain threat created by AI coding tools
Forget typosquatting; a new software supply chain threat, termed "slopsquatting," is emerging due to AI coding tools. Enabled by large language model (LLM) hallucinations, this attack allows cybercriminals to inject malicious code directly into development workflows. Attackers register fake, plausible package names—often mimicking legitimate libraries—which AI coding assistants then recommend, bypassing traditional security protections. Trunk Tools' stack cut document review from 60 days to 10 by ditching general-purpose models
Construction data presents a unique challenge: most general-purpose AI models struggle with the industry’s jargon-dense, abbreviation-heavy documents. Trunk Tools addresses this by building a specialized, three-layer architecture—perception, semantics, and agents—to transform data chaos into agent-ready workflows. This purpose-built stack has dramatically reduced document review cycles from months to days and prevents costly field errors.

Morgan Stanley cut its riskiest reconciliation job in half — by making its agents less autonomous
Morgan Stanley dramatically accelerated a critical reconciliation process—profit and loss (P&L) reconciliation—by deploying an internal AI agentic system called FIXR. Counterintuitively, the firm achieved a 50% reduction in processing time by prioritizing human oversight and iteratively incorporating controller decisions into automated rules. This "co-worker" approach, rather than a fully autonomous model, unlocks complex organizational workflows and exemplifies a shift toward process-first AI implementation, as highlighted by Morgan Stanley’s Managing Director, Todd Johnson.
